In determining how long Butter & Margarine lasts, our content incorporates research from multiple resources, including the United States … Butter does, indeed, expire. Even if kept in the refrigerator, it eventually will go bad, which is why a good jumping-off point is checking the expiration date on the box or wrapper. Butter should keep—at the very least—until that date.
